Q: Is 4,248,772 a Prime Number?
A: No, 4,248,772 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 4248772 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 11 22 44 61 122 244 671 1,342 1,583 2,684 3,166 6,332 17,413 34,826 69,652 96,563 193,126 386,252 1,062,193 2,124,386 and 4,248,772, with no remainder.
Since 4,248,772 cannot be divided by just 1 and 4,248,772, it is not a prime number.
